Well break down the virology, epidemiology, clinical presentation, and complications of Parvovirus B19. Parvovirus B19 is best known for causing fifth disease, but in certain patients it can lead to some serious complications like aplastic crises, fetal hydrops, or chronic anemia. Preventive care refers to medical services that focus on early detection, routine screenings, and health counseling. It includes things like vaccinations, blood pressure checks, cancer screenings, and annual physicals. A physical exam , on the other hand, involves a hands-on evaluation by a provider.
